Even with great features the prices stay reasonable so anyone can afford a portable system. Let’s take the<strong> HP g60-249 notebook </strong>for example and analyze it. It is powered by a 2.00 GHz AMD Athlon X2 QL-62 Dual-Core processor.

Memory installed is 3GB and you can choose to add an upgrade and put a total of 4GB in it. Even the initial amount will make sure your systems runs smooth enough and will perform multiple-tasking without a hiccup. Video graphics in this case is NVIDIA GeForce 8200M and the video memory go up to 1407MB. The hard drive stores 250GB, being more than enough to save all your files and folders. You can afterwards put you data on CDs or DVDs with the SuperMulti 8X DVD±R/RW with Double Layer Support multimedia drive.

The <strong>display </strong>is <strong>16</strong>.0” diagonal High-Definition HP with BrightView technology at 1366×768 resolution. Movies will look sharp and the images crisp with this screen. You can choose to connect to the internet with the high-speed 56k modem and the integrated 10/100 Ethernet LAN. Wireless connectivity is also possible with the 802.11b/g WLAN. Speakers built-in are Altec Lansing and they have the requirements to give quality sound with clear toned even at a higher level of volume.

As for external ports there is a 5-in-one digital media card reader to allow you to connect with other digital gadgets having MultiMedia cards, Memory Stick, Memory Stick Pro, or xD Picture cards or Secure Digital cards. There are three USB ports, one port for each microphone and headphone, one HDMI, one VGA port, one for LAn and one for the modem. This notebooks weights 6.52lbs and it has the following dimensions: 14.88″ (L) x 9.9″ (D) x 1.38″ (min H)/1.61″ (max H).
There is a 6-Cell Lithium-Ion battery, which will last for about 2-3 hours. The operating system is Windows Vista Home Premium along with other software already included and installed on your computer. The antivirus HP uses is Norton and this is the case also giving 60 days of update. The warranty is for one year and don’t forget about the online support which is unlimited if you have any questions, or you need additional materials such as drivers, manuals or you just need some answers to your questions.
